Understanding the Role of an Accident Attorney
When an accident happens due to someone else's carelessness, the victim is lawfully entitled to look for payment. Insurance provider, however, are services created to lessen payments. Adjusters are trained to safeguard business bottom lines, often by using fast, lowball settlements or using declarations made by the victim against them.
A skilled accident lawyer serves as a fierce supporter, leveling the playing field. Their duties include:
- Investigating the accident: Gathering authorities reports, witness declarations, and surveillance video footage.
- Calculating damages: Assessing current and future medical costs, lost making capability, and discomfort and suffering.
- Managing communication: Managing all correspondence with insurer so the client can focus entirely on recovery.
- Working out settlements: Fighting for a fair resolution beyond court.
- Litigating in court: Filing a suit and representing the customer before a judge and jury if a reasonable settlement can not be reached.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 )Whenshould I contact a local accident attorney? It is best to call an attorney as soon as possible after getting medical attention. Proofcan fade rapidly, skid marks vanish, and monitoring footage might be overwritten. Moreover, contacting a lawyer early prevents insurance provider from capitalizingof you throughout susceptible minutes. Howmuch does it cost to employ an accident lawyer?
The majority of accident attorneys operate on a contingency charge contract. This suggests there are no upfront costs or per hour charges. The attorney takes an agreed-upon portion( generally in between 33%and 40%)just if they successfully win a settlement or court award for you. What if I was partly at fault for the accident? Depending on the
state, you may still be eligible to recuperate settlement
even if you share a portion of the blame. States run under either "relative carelessness" or"contributory neglect" guidelines. A regional attorney will know how your state's particular laws use to your degree of fault. Should I talk to the other driver'sinsurance provider? It is usually advised not to give a recorded
declaration or accept a settlement offer from the opposing insurer without consulting a lawyer first. Anything you state can be twisted and used to cheapen or reject your claim.
